Frequently Asked Questions about Vancouver
How much are Studio apartments in Vancouver?
There are currently 3,113 Studio Apartments in Vancouver with rent ranges from $1,250 to $8,481 with an average price of $2,348.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Vancouver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Vancouver ranges from $1,300 to $10,924 with an average monthly rent of $2,751.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Vancouver c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Vancouver range from $2,100 to $15,003.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,102.
How expensive are Vancouver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 596 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Vancouver on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,250 to $21,352 - averaging $6,789 for the location.
